Driveway paving in Elkville

Drives off a state highway get pounded at the apron, where every vehicle turns and brakes on the same few feet. We build that section with extra rock and clean supported edges, then carry a compacted base down the length of the drive. Hot-mix typically goes 2 to 3 inches compacted for cars and pickups, deeper where a work truck or trailer parks.

Parking lot paving in Elkville

A storefront lot on Route 51, a church lot, or a shop and equipment yard all need the same planning: base sized for delivery trucks, entrances built where tires turn hardest, and a grade that sends water to a planned outlet. We place asphalt in lifts and compact it tight. A firm older lot may just need repairs and seal coating.

Road construction & private roads

Private lanes, shared drives and access roads around the village rut first in the wheel paths, which is exactly where water sits. We crown them over compacted rock, thicken the base at stops and turns, and pick asphalt or chip seal depending on whether the lane carries loaded trucks or mostly cars.

Why the base matters in Elkville

Clay-heavy soils common through this region stay soft for days after rain, and pavement built over soft ground cracks early. Freeze-thaw winters finish the job by lifting the surface from below. We grade so runoff leaves fast, cut out the soft subgrade, and compact clean rock in layers before anything gets paved.

When you compare bids, ask each contractor for three numbers in writing: the compacted asphalt thickness, the base depth, and what happens to the water. Those three decide how long the surface lasts.

Compacted asphaltTypically 2 to 3 in. for a car drive
Stone baseTypically 4 to 8 in., compacted
Drive on itUsually 2 to 3 days, longer in heat
First sealcoatTypically 6 to 12 months after paving

Typical ranges. Your Elkville estimate is sized to the soil, the traffic and the drainage on your property.

How long before I can park on a new driveway?

Usually a day or two before normal car traffic, but fresh asphalt stays soft for weeks while it cures. Keep trailer jacks, kickstands and sharp standing turns off it early, and avoid heavy trucks. We give you specifics for your job and the weather that week.

Do you pave in Elkville in the winter?

Hot-mix asphalt needs warm air and warm ground to compact properly, and the plants serving Elkville typically run from spring into late fall. Winter is a good time to get your estimate and book a spot for the season.
